Report: Liverpool consider surprise sale of 27-year-old first team starter
The mood around Anfield is shifting heavily toward a massive summer rebuild.
With several iconic names potentially clearing out their lockers, the rumour mill has thrown up a major surprise.
Liverpool’s hierarchy are growing increasingly tempted to entertain offers for midfield orchestrator Alexis Mac Allister, according to Football Insider.
When Mac Allister joined the Reds back in 2023, he quickly became the beating heart of their midfield setup. However, the World Cup winner’s form has dipped slightly this campaign.
He is about to enter the final two years of his current deal. Typically, this is the exact moment clubs look to secure their prized assets with lucrative fresh terms.
Instead, Mac Allister himself recently admitted to the press that there is “no rush” to sit down at the negotiating table.
Alexis Mac Allister to leave Liverpool for Real Madrid?
Real Madrid have been heavily linked with the Argentine for a while, viewing him as the perfect creative profile to refresh their own engine room.
What makes this potential transfer even more fascinating is the financial reality currently facing manager Arne Slot.
Slot has openly admitted the club is in transition and needs to “recoup our money and to spend again” to fund necessary structural changes across the squad.
Cashing in on Mac Allisterw, hose market value remains sky-high, could be the ultimate necessary evil to bankroll the next era at Anfield.
If they can secure a hefty fee, it would give the club a massive war chest to inject fresh talent.
Crystal Palace’s Adam Wharton and Real Madrid’s Eduardo Camavinga have been linked with a move to Anfield in recent weeks.
Reds are looking to refresh their midfield this summer
If the Reds are looking to sign a new midfielder, they would have to raise transfer funds through player sales.
Selling a player of Mac Allister’s undeniable quality is always a massive gamble. He was a crucial part of the title winning team last season under Slot.
However, the Merseyside club may have to make some difficult decisions if they want to rebuild their squad.
With Real Madrid circling and a desperate need to finance a summer squad overhaul, the prospect of the Argentine swapping Merseyside for the Spanish capital is suddenly looking like a very realistic outcome.
